    Myelination and the trophic support of long axons. Nave KA(1). ... In addition to their role in providing myelin for rapid impulse propagation, the glia that ensheath long axons are required for the maintenance of normal axon transport and long-term survival. This presumably ancestral function seems to be independent of myelin membrane wrapping.Cited by: 462

    Energy for the axon, in the form of ATP, is partly generated from glucose transporters on neuronal cell bodies, but it is likely that local energy is required to maintain axon function along its long course. Access to extracellular glucose is restricted in most long axons by the presence of myelin (Glossary), a hydrophobic barrier surrounding axons.Cited by: 180
